Linux下配置和安装VNCServer远程服务

VNCServer 一款远程服务工具,在linux下安装可以通过windows版的vnc viewer访问

1,首先下载安装vncserver

[wuzhiyi@localhost Downloads]$ sudo rpm -ivh vnc-server-4.1.2-14.el5_6.6.i386.rpm 

输入rpm -qa|grep vnc检查是否安装成功

如果显示:

vnc-server-4.1.2-14.el5_6.6.i386

则表示安装成功

2,配置vncserver文件

打开vncserver配置文件(注意在修改配置文件时切换到root)

[root@localhost ~]# vim /etc/sysconfig/vncservers

在最后加上

VNCSERVERS="1:root"                                   设置登录“显示号”和用户

VNCSERVERARGS[1]="-geometry 1024x768"    设置屏幕分辨率

3,配置xstartup文件

[wuzhiyi@localhost Downloads]$ vncserver 

You will require a password to access your desktops.

Password:
Verify:

输入口令:123

[root@localhost ~]# vim /root/.vnc/xstartup 

#!/bin/sh

#Uncomment the following two lines for normal desktop:

unset SESSION_MANAGER  (去掉前面的注释号)

exec /etc/X11/xinit/xinitrc(去掉前面的注释号)

[ -x /etc/vnc/xstartup ] exec /etc/vnc/xstartup

[ -r $HOME/.Xresources ] xrdb $HOME/.Xresources

xsetroot -solid grey

vncconfig -iconic  &

xterm -geometry 80x24+10+10 -ls -title "$VNCDESKTOP Desktop" &

twm &

gnome-session & set starting GNOME desktop (增加这一行,表使用gnome界面,否则是xfce界面)

保存后退出。

4.设置远程登录口令

[root@localhost ~]# vncpasswd

Password:123456

Verify:123456

5,启动vncserver服务

[root@localhost ~]# service vncserver start

可以启动多个界面

[root@localhost ~]# vncserver :2(第二个界面)

6,停止vncserver服务

[root@localhost ~]# vncserver -kill :4

检查服务是否开启

[root@localhost ~]# chkconfig --list vncserver

[root@localhost ~]# chkconfig vncserver on

7,通过客户端vnc viewer来远程

格式:主机ip地址:1(窗口界面号)

输入密码(12356)即可登陆

vncserver一定要关闭linux防火墙才可正常访问

[root@localhost ~]# service iptables stop

原文地址:https://www.cnblogs.com/wuzhiyi/p/4624531.html